BROWNING, MICHAEL G (IN) Federal Political Campaign Donations in the 1991-1992 Election Cycle

Updated on February 27, 2025.

According to FEC data, in the 1991-1992 election cycle, BROWNING, MICHAEL G made a total donation of $14,250 to 5 unique election committees. DEMOCRATIC SENATORIAL CAMPAIGN COMMITTEE (DEM) received the highest donation ($10,000), followed by COATS, DANIEL R (REP) ($2,000), and HOGSETT, JOSEPH H (DEM) ($1,000).
